Todo: Fix a submap loading code and an area loading code, or maybe not. I'll get around to repacking it later and showing it off on the article on a separate subpage if there is anything at all. Meanwhile the pb1 folder has 30 elements (mapdata). If I'm correct, then it loads from the pb2 folder which has 20 elements (there are only 20 puzzle boy maps). This pops up in the console every time you go into a new part of puzzle boy. There might be some unused puzzle boy map data inside the pb1 folder. Maybe the debug menu just has a trigger or something that makes it work. if we could find a way to load them without loading a file, then it could be possible to use them without going into the debug menu. Some debug options simply give you a black screen, but the functions are still there. it doesn't go any further than this.Ī lot of debug options seem to loop back, meaning that a dev kit could've been used under development or they were just disabled. The options that return to the debug menu are defunct debug options.

Below is a list of all Magatamas in the game. In general, Magatamas are very important and they allow you to customize the Demi-Fiend how you want. In addition to abilities and stats, Magatamas also affect what strengths and weaknesses the Demi-Fiend has. Each Magatama has a set of skills the Demi-Fiend can learn. As you level, the skills that the Demi-Fiend learns will be dependent upon the Magatamas. As you proceed further and further into the game though, you will obtain more Magatamas in various ways. In doing so, he is granted different stats and abilities. Magatama are digestible bugs that the Demi-Fiend can ingest.
